And because folks at Hallmark have really learned how to tug on those heartstrings, their new series of Mother's Day ads asked people to describe the love and gratitude they have for their mothers. The best part: Little did the participants know, their moms were listening in to their conversations the entire time. So, each video captured a mom's reaction to her children's touching words. (Now, we're going to be optimistic and adorably naive and assume these were not paid actors.)

Created for the brand's #PutYourHeartToPaper campaign, the series includes seven videos where the interviewer asked people to describe how much they loved their moms without using the phrases "I love you" and "thank you."

"I feel like with her actions every day she teaches me what it means to love someone," one daughter said about her mother in one of the videos. Another daughter described her mother as her soulmate, "People always talk about ‘Oh there're soulmates in the world' and I don’t know if I believe in all that stuff but if there were soulmates I know she’s my soulmate. I’ve never yet met somebody that I connect with and love and care about and think about more than my mom."

Another video had a son talk about how his single mom, "not just gave him birth, but gave him a life." Heart melted, right?
